Transaction 705486800cd1cf6ffb9f4bd8dc6b481de96c58bed7044376f232a676bfe7010c

5 Input
2 Outputs
  • 705486800cd1cf6ffb9f4bd8dc6b481de96c58bed7044376f232a676bfe7010c:0
  • value  1027900
    address  335BhWGMFXzuEpsLKZorEho8ZHuxboB5o5
  • 705486800cd1cf6ffb9f4bd8dc6b481de96c58bed7044376f232a676bfe7010c:1
  • value  102647
    address  3GBEAe98tgkQKB1pubyi9BbmzKQumoXzMb